Key Buying Factors for a Portable 4×6 Photo Printer

Connection Type

Wi-Fi is usually the most flexible choice for a Portable 4×6 Photo Printer, especially if more than one person will print. Bluetooth can be simpler for direct phone printing, and USB or docking features may suit desk use.

Print Technology and Finish

Most models in this category use dye-sublimation or similar full-color processes that produce durable, smudge-resistant 4×6 prints. Look for instant-dry output if you want photos that are ready to handle right away.

Running Costs

Check the included sheet count, ribbon packs, and the cost of replacement consumables. A printer that comes with more paper and ribbons may be a better value if you plan to print often.

Portability and Ease of Use

True portability means more than a small footprint. Consider weight, setup time, and whether the printer works cleanly from a mobile app. If you plan to bring it to parties, trips, or events, convenience matters as much as print quality.
